For the last two years, the Australian Childcare Alliance (ACA) NSW has been aware of the arguably false information contained on the Federal Government's MyChild website, namely when then almost 900 childcare services have not been re-assessed and re-rated for 2-6 years.

The problem being that when the MyChild website does not tell prospective parents when the service was last re-assessed and re-rated, and it tells prospective parents that they are on a lower rating like "Working Toward" when they are operating as a "Meeting" or "Exceeding" level of service, such incorrect ratings harms such services and their viabilities to continue operating especially if they are in an area with an oversupply of childcare services.

The office of the Federal Minister for Education, Senator the Hon SImon Birmingham, has confirmed to ACA NSW on 12 August 2018, that the new MyChild replacement website will now feature when the service is last assessed and rated.

ACA NSW thanks Minister Birmingham's office and appreciates this correction.
